public class ComponentRegistry extends Object
| Constructor and Description |
|---|
ComponentRegistry()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
addComponent(RegistrationInfoImpl ri) |
boolean |
contains(ComponentName name) |
void |
destroy() |
RegistrationInfoImpl |
getComponent(ComponentName name) |
Collection<RegistrationInfoImpl> |
getComponents() |
RegistrationInfoImpl[] |
getComponentsArray() |
Set<ComponentName> |
getMissingDependencies(ComponentName name) |
Map<ComponentName,Set<ComponentName>> |
getPendingComponents() |
boolean |
isResolved(ComponentName name) |
RegistrationInfoImpl |
removeComponent(ComponentName name) |
int |
size() |
public void destroy()
public final boolean isResolved(ComponentName name)
public boolean addComponent(RegistrationInfoImpl ri) throws Exception
ri - Exceptionpublic RegistrationInfoImpl removeComponent(ComponentName name) throws Exception
Exceptionpublic Set<ComponentName> getMissingDependencies(ComponentName name)
public RegistrationInfoImpl getComponent(ComponentName name)
public boolean contains(ComponentName name)
public int size()
public Collection<RegistrationInfoImpl> getComponents()
public RegistrationInfoImpl[] getComponentsArray()
public Map<ComponentName,Set<ComponentName>> getPendingComponents()
Copyright © 2012 Nuxeo SA. All Rights Reserved.